What are AI agents in education?
AI agents in education are designed to perform specific academic or administrative tasks autonomously. Unlike chatbots that follow pre-defined scripts, AI agents use machine learning, natural language processing (NLP), and data analytics to understand context, provide personalized responses, and make real-time decisions.
For example, an AI agent can:
- Act as a virtual tutor helping students understand difficult concepts
- Function as an academic advisor, recommending courses based on performance
- Serve as an administrative assistant, answering student queries or managing schedules
These agents work 24/7, offering seamless communication and adaptive learning experiences.
How do AI agents in education differ from other types of AI
Understanding the differences between AI technologies helps explain why agentic AI is particularly valuable in today’s adaptive learning environments. Basic or rule-based AI systems perform predefined tasks, following programmed instructions such as checking grammar, recording attendance, or analyzing test results. While useful for repetitive tasks, these systems lack flexibility, contextual understanding, and the ability to take initiative.
Generative AI, on the other hand, focuses on creating new content like lesson plans, quizzes, or topic summaries. It excels at drafting materials and supporting creative processes but doesn’t act independently or make decisions based on real-time learning contexts.
Agentic AI represents the next evolution in educational technology. These systems can monitor student progress, learn from interactions, and act autonomously to provide personalized support. For instance, they can recommend tailored learning activities or proactively identify students who may need extra guidance. In essence, agentic AI doesn’t just respond, it takes initiative, delivering continuous, intelligent support that enhances both teaching and learning experiences.
Top use cases of AI agents in education
Agentic AI is rapidly reshaping classrooms and digital learning environments. These intelligent systems go beyond basic automation, they actively enhance learning experiences, simplify operations, and help educators focus on what matters most: teaching. From personalized learning to intelligent administration, AI agents are driving meaningful change across education.
Here are some of the most transformative and practical applications of AI agents in education today:
Proactive student support
AI agents continuously monitor student performance and engagement, identifying those who may need extra help before issues escalate. They can send timely reminders, offer resources, or connect learners with instructors ensuring no student is left behind.
Intelligent administrative automation
From managing admissions and attendance to handling routine inquiries, AI agents streamline time-consuming tasks. This automation reduces manual workload for staff and allows institutions to operate more efficiently, with real-time responsiveness.
Adaptive learning pathways
By analyzing individual progress and learning styles, AI agents create personalized study plans that evolve as students advance. The result is a dynamic, data-driven approach to education that adjusts content difficulty and pacing for every learner.
Autonomous tutoring agents
These AI-powered tutors act as round-the-clock academic companions. They can answer questions, explain concepts, and provide instant feedback, extending classroom support into an interactive, on-demand learning experience.
In essence, AI agents are transforming education from a static system into a living, responsive ecosystem, one that empowers both educators and students through intelligent, proactive engagement.
Benefits of AI agents in education
When implemented effectively, AI agents can significantly enhance both teaching and learning experiences. Unlike static educational tools, Agentic AI systems adapt dynamically, providing personalized support that benefits every participant in the educational journey.
Tailored learning for every student
AI agents can tailor learning to each student’s unique needs, preferences, and progress. They go beyond simple adaptive quizzes or flashcards, selecting the most effective teaching methods, revisiting concepts that learners struggle with, and adjusting delivery styles in real time to maximize understanding.
Instant feedback for continuous improvement
Students no longer have to wait for assessments to identify gaps. AI agents provide instant feedback, explaining mistakes and offering follow-up exercises that reinforce key concepts. This continuous support accelerates learning while boosting confidence and independence.
Proactive risk mitigation
AI agents monitor engagement and performance, identifying students at risk of falling behind. They can trigger timely interventions, such as notifying advisors or suggesting targeted resources, helping educators address challenges before they become serious problems.
Personalized support at scale
Personalized attention becomes possible even in large classes or remote settings. AI agents offer on-demand guidance and answer student questions, constantly adapting to individual needs. This ensures equitable learning opportunities regardless of class size, location, or schedule constraints.
Empowering teachers with intelligent assistance
Far from replacing teachers, AI agents serve as intelligent assistants. By handling administrative tasks and analyzing student progress, they free educators to focus on personalized instruction and meaningful student interactions. This creates a more effective, engaging, and fulfilling teaching environment.
